Transaction dd609a5c3568e76511f8c8b01a7b197939067671a7968c8491791fe716803373
1 Input
1 Output
-
dd609a5c3568e76511f8c8b01a7b197939067671a7968c8491791fe716803373:0
- value
- 274416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3716b5023c576aab7742e089432c9da49f20421 OP_EQUAL
- address
- 3KWRZTJRUboohJkW9n3wSh4v8z5t3JdKgC